Apps and web apps and the future
december 2011 by kvnglbrtsn
"I think instead that we’ll see a more tangled future. Native apps will use HTML, CSS, and JavaScript more. Web apps will appear more often on smart phones as launchable apps. Native apps will support linking in and out more. Web apps will move more processing to the client — they’ll be written more like native apps."

Why apps are not the future
december 2011 by kvnglbrtsn
"The great thing about the web is linking. I don't care how ugly it looks and how pretty your app is, if I can't link in and out of your world, it's not even close to a replacement for the web."

Realism in UI Design
january 2010 by kvnglbrtsn
The goal is not to make your user interface as realistic as possible. The goal is to add those details which help users identify what an element is, and how to interact with it, and to add no more than those details.

Resilience Fail (updated)
november 2009 by kvnglbrtsn
URL-shorteners violate three key principles of resilient design: they offer no transparency, no redundancy, and no decentralization. They're classic single-points of failure.

Idempotence -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
august 2009 by kvnglbrtsn
Idempotence (pronounced /ˌaɪdɨmˈpoʊtəns/) describes the property of operations in mathematics and computer science which means that multiple applications of the operation do not change the result.
